    The 1st ‘three-headed’ asteroid photo of the day for Aug. 3, 2026

    A collage of images of asteroid (44) Nysa, believed to be the first-known asteroid in our solar system to have a “trilobate” or three-headed shape. (Image credit: ESO/K. Minker et al.)

    New images reveal what astronomers believe is the first-known “trilobate” or three-headed asteroid in our solar system.

    What is it?

    These new images capture the asteroid known as (44) Nysa, or just Nysa, as it spins through the main asteroid belt located between Mars and Jupiter. The images were captured with the Very Large Telescope in Chile and the Large Binocular Telescope in Arizona.

    Nysa was first observed in 1857, but it wasn’t until the new images were captured when scientists were able to resolve its unique three-headed structure. The asteroid appears to be around 47 miles (75 kilometers) in circumference at its widest point, with two narrow “necks” that give it its odd “trilobate” shape.

    Even more incredible, astronomers were also able to resolve that a 0.6-mile-wide (1-km-wide) moon seems to orbit Nysa. The tiny moon, currently known as S/2026 (44) 1, appears to orbit the asteroid at a distance of around 106 miles (170 km).

    An image of the three-headed asteroid (44) Nysa and its small moon S/2026 (44) 1, identified here by a pink arrow. The image was produced by the Large Binocular Telescope in Arizona. (Image credit: Kate Minker et al.)

    Why is it incredible?

    Astronomers say these images reveal (44) Nysa to be unlike any other asteroid we’ve seen in our neck of the cosmic woods.

    “The images reveal a remarkably unusual object,” said Kate Minker of Arizona’s Lowell Observatory in a statement announcing the discovery. “The most likely explanation is that Nysa is either a contact trinary, consisting of three connected components, or an extremely irregular coherent body unlike anything we’ve previously observed.”

    Scientists can study asteroids like Nysa to learn about how the planets of our solar system formed. Nysa belongs to a class of asteroids believed to have formed closer to the inner solar system and therefore may have a similar composition to the building blocks that would go on to form the inner planets.
